Libraries

The Central Library of the University is a veritable beehive for management students containing multiple copies of text and reference books in all functional areas of Management. The Department Library has exclusive reading rooms for teachers/scholars and students, offering reference books available on a wide range of subjects, including encyclopaedia, dictionaries, gazetteers, Govt. Publications, World bank publications, etc. Newspapers and periodical collections of the library covers various current affairs and a wide range of specialized subjects.

Students have access to about 40,000 books and over 300 journals in the library both Indian and foreign. The number of subscribed newspapers is about 20. The stock and services of the library are aimed at catering to the needs of postgraduate students, researchers, public and private sector managers, professional groups and academics.

Facilities are available to the students for having photocopies of relevant portions of books and journals, subject to copyright restrictions.

Computer Set-Up

The Department has two sophisticated Computer Rooms with a number of Servers & PCs with multi-terminal facilities and a number of Management Systems Packages.

The department is equipped with LAN setup (Windows NT and Novell Intranetware). The Department's Computer Set-up offers a range of Programming Environments (MS Visual Studio, RDBMS, C & C++ compilers etc.) The LAN set-up provides adequate exposure to networking.

The Computer Centre also offers several Statistical Packages, CASE tools and Project Management Software, E-Commerce packages relevant for Management study and for undertaking research study and also Multimedia facilities, keeping in touch with the latest demands of the industry.

The Computer Centre conducts hands-on practical sessions for students of all current courses. The Centre also conducts management development programs on computer applications, maintaining an exhaustive data-base of functional areas of the department, which is extremely useful to the department's faculty and the students. The department has inducted E-Commerce as part of its course curriculum and is being considered as a Nodal Centre for diffusion of E-Commerce education at University level.

Teaching Aids

The Department is equipped with audio-visual facilities for the reproduction of teaching material and other outputs of the department. Conceived as an interactive symbiotic process, teaching in the course is conducted primarily on lecture-discussion basis, supplemented by regular case analysis, workshops, field studies and independent project works. The Department has provisions for audio-visual aids and other equipment's like overhead projectors, slide projectors, video recorders, tape recorders, film projectors and computers for use by faculty and students.
